Canoe Adventure Day Tours – Full Day Tour

Canoe adventure day tours offer a range of tour options. From short, to half day, to full day tours, there is something to suit all abilities and fitness levels. Canoe tours are a great way to get up close to the wetlands and explore the various waterways that make up the Riverland. The full-day tour is an extension of the half-day, allowing you to explore deeper into the Loch Luna wetlands and Chambers Creek. The Loch Luna wetlands are rich with bird life and natural beauty. During your tour, you may come across pelicans and swans floating along the lake, eagles nesting high above in the trees, and towering gums surrounded by red cliffs. The tour includes, morning tea, lunch and a sample of local produce to keep you going throughout the day.

Banrock Station Wine – Wetlands Tour & Tasting

Banrock Station Wine & Wetland Centre offers one of the most unique Riverland tours. Banrock Station has been producing wine in South Australia since the 1960s and the vineyard and cellar door are set within the 1000 hectares of wetlands. The guided Wetlands Tour & Tasting gives you the best of both worlds. Explore the amazing environments with a knowledgeable guide and finish off with a guided wine tasting. The tour is 90 minutes and includes morning tea and refreshments. You can even extend your stay with lunch on their deck looking out to the beautiful wetlands.

Rivergum Cruises – Sunset Tour

What better way is there to explore the Riverland than cruising across the water? Rivergum Cruises offers a wide range of Riverland tours from short, to long, to ‘design your own’. Hop aboard for a sunset cruise and glide along the Murray River, watching as the horizon turns into beautiful hues of pink which reflect on the water. Complimentary tea and coffee and a grazing platter of local produce are included on your river tour. There is also a licensed bar to purchase an alcoholic tipple as you watch the sun go down behind the limestone cliffs.

Mallee Estate Wines – Indulge Tour

A visit to one of the Riverland’s finest wineries is an absolute must during your stay. Mallee Estate Wines is a family-run winery with three vineyards in total, a cellar door, and an award-winning restaurant. The winemakers offer a variety of tours to suit all budgets and tastes. If you are looking for an extra special experience, then the indulge tour could be just for you. The tour is guided by second-generation winemaker Jim Markeas who provides you with firsthand knowledge of the winemaking process and the history of the winery. Along the way, you will be able to try a top-quality red and white wine straight from the tank and a Tawny and Muscat direct from the French oak barrel. The experience also includes a delicious cheese platter for two and a Mallee Estate branded wine glass to take home as a reminder of your visit.
